Web15 mei 2015 · 1. Restart the computer and after the chime press and hold down the left mouse button until the disc ejects. 2. Press the Eject button on your keyboard. 3. Click on the Eject button in the menubar. 4. Press COMMAND-E. 5. If none of the above work try this: Open the Terminal application in your Utilities folder.
